We are a big fan of White Sheep and today we gave a try to Sheep's Food District. I liked the different setup of this restaurant and their amazing decor. Having 3 different kitchen in 1 restaurant is very nice . Today we tried Joe's Trucker Street food truck. We had Baja Shrimp , Chicken Tinga and Chi town tacos. Chi town taco was basically Italian beef with jardinera but we still liked it. Baja Shrimp is something I am looking to eat again. And the juciy tender chicken with avocado sauce in Chicken Tinga tacos were delish ? I also ordered Gnocchi Gorgonzola but didn't like it much , the creamy sauce they used was super watered down and tasteless so I wouldn't order that again. Lemon margarita was okay .Our server Patrick was very friendly and he served us in timely manner.I am looking forward to visiting this restaurant again to try their Pizza and BBQ kitchens.
